Ingredients
- 8 ounces dried beef
- 1 cup cream or milk
- 2 tablespoons butter
- 2 tablespoons flour
- Salt and pepper to taste
Preparation
Step 1
Add just enough water to cover the beef. Let stand for half an hour. Pour off water and rinse beef off well. (This removes excess salt)
Add cream, salt and pepper and let it come to a slow boil. Melt butter and stir in flour; add to milk and beef mixture, and let it
come to a boil and cook until it thickens up.
Serve on toast or boiled new potatoes.
